Due to work at Riem station, there will be stop cancellations and rail replacement services on the S-Bahn line S7 from Wednesday, 2 June.
Erding – Deutsche Bahn (DB) is continuing the barrier-free expansion of Riem station and is also working on overhead lines in the Feldkirchen area. For this reason, there will be extensive timetable changes from this Wednesday evening at 22.45 p.m. until Monday, 12 June, 3.30 a.m.
Between Riem and Markt Schwaben, all S-Bahn lines of the S2 will be replaced by buses. According to a statement from the railway, this will extend the travel time on this route by about 20 minutes. On Friday, 9 June, an express bus will also connect Markt Schwaben station directly and without intermediate stops with the Messestadt Ost underground station. The direct bus runs every 6 minutes from 21 a.m. to 20 p.m. and takes just under half an hour.
Because of the work in Riem, the S-Bahn stops there at a temporary platform. Due to limited line capacity, the stops in Grub and Berg am Laim will be cancelled on the S2 trains running into the city from 12 June to 15 September. For passengers to and from Grub, a bus replacement service has been set up from Poing via Grub to Heimstetten. Passengers to Berg am Laim can alternatively use tram 19 (Einsteinstraße stop) from Leuchtenbergring or bus line 190 from Ostbahnhof. The S-Bahn trains in the direction of the city are not affected by the stop cancellations and run regularly with stops at all stations.
